The show season looms!
The 2015 show season is about to start in earnest! Dartmoor Magazine has a pretty packed programme this summer: do come and say hello if you happen to be passing. It’s Dartmoor Folk Festival (www.dartmoorfolkfestival.org.uk)at South Zeal this coming weekend (we’ll be in the Crafts Marquee on Saturday and Sunday), a wonderful time of traditional music, singing and dance in a beautiful setting. Next we’re taking the gazebo to Harrowbeer 1940s Weekend on 15 and 16 August: a must for anyone interested in military history and a spot of World War II nostalgia.
On 20 August we’ll be in the gazebo at the popular and long-standing Chagford Show, on 29 August (a new one for us) at Sampford Spiney and Walkhampton Sheepdog Trials (a good chance to get some photos to support an article on the subject commissioned for 2016), and on 5 September at the Nourish Festival in Bovey Tracey. And finally we’ll be at good old Widecombe Fair on Tuesday 8 September, where I always particularly enjoy visiting the local produce tent…
… as well as watching the livestock classes, of course!
